One of the key steps in successfully closing a gaming business is to communicate openly and honestly with stakeholders, including employees, investors, and customers. Transparency can help in minimizing negative impact and fostering trust in the industry. When it comes to finishing strategies, Israeli gaming businesses can explore various options to gracefully exit the market while maximizing the value created. One approach is to consider mergers or acquisitions with other companies in the industry. By joining forces with a strategic partner, a gaming business can leverage shared resources and expertise to create a stronger position in the market. Another finishing strategy is to focus on intellectual property (IP) and asset management. Gaming companies in Israel can strategically license or sell their IP to other developers or publishers, generating revenue and ensuring that their creations continue to thrive in the industry beyond their closure. Additionally, investing in the development of a solid exit plan from the early stages can help businesses prepare for unexpected challenges and ensure a smoother transition when the time comes. Furthermore, networking and seeking guidance from industry professionals and organizations can offer valuable insights and support during the closure process. By engaging with the gaming community in Israel, businesses can explore alternative opportunities, collaborate on new projects, and potentially pave the way for a fresh start in the future.
